  • Well here it is. My first drive on the stage 2 setup from Integrated Engineering on my 2010 Volkswagen Jetta 2.5. My reaction? Do it! It is worth every penny. My recommendation is to buy the power kit that includes all the items to go stage 2. It is just easier that way. Many intakes can be modified to work with this manifold but the IE intake will bolt right up to it. (obviously)

    • @VoyageRC
      @VoyageRC  3 ปีที่แล้ว

      @@HyperSlayer72 Its just a shift in the power band. It hits harder up top. Its hard to describe the low RPM range of power. Its not really a “loss” over stage 1 as much as you dont gain any down low. All the gains are mid to upper range. So really it just prefers to be in that range and driving like you typically would for good fuel economy, by keeping the RPMs low, doesnt work as well on this tune.   • @PrestigiousBurrito
    @PrestigiousBurrito ปีที่แล้ว

    I see that the power kit is only for the manual mk5 but is it posible to be put on a automatic?

    • @VoyageRC
      @VoyageRC  ปีที่แล้ว +1

      The power kit will work on manual and auto cars. The real factor is whether or not you have electric or hydraulic power steering. The manifold is not compatible with hydraulic power steering. You will also want to tune your transmission if automatic.
